Understanding Gas Pool Heater Basics

A gas pool heater, as the name suggests, is a heating system designed to warm water in your swimming pool using natural gas as its fuel source. Understanding the fundamentals of how these heaters operate and what factors influence their pricing is crucial for any homeowner considering this investment. This section delves into the basic concepts, offering an insightful guide to help you navigate the market effectively.
Gas pool heaters function by burning natural gas, which generates heat that’s transferred to the water in your pool. The core component is a heating unit, typically located at the bottom of the pool or in a dedicated plumbing pittsburgh area, depending on the model and installation preferences. A series of coils within this unit facilitates the heat exchange process, ensuring efficient warming of the pool water. Many modern models also incorporate advanced safety features, such as automatic shut-off valves and temperature sensors, to prevent overheating and potential hazards.

Factors Influencing Price: A Deep Dive

When it comes to purchasing a gas pool heater, the price can vary significantly based on several factors. Understanding these influences is essential for any buyer looking to make an informed decision, especially when comparing different models from reputable brands like Sanders Plumbing. One of the primary considerations is the gas pool heater line—the type and size of the gas source connection. Different heaters may require specific line sizes (e.g., 1/2″ or 3/4″) and pressure ratings, impacting initial installation costs and potential long-term operational expenses. For instance, a larger line diameter can facilitate higher heating capacity but may also incur additional plumbing work if not already available.
Another critical factor is the heater’s efficiency and energy rating. High-efficiency models, often labeled with Energy Star certification, typically command a premium due to their superior performance in converting fuel into heat. These heaters can significantly reduce running costs over time, making them a worthwhile investment for pool owners. For context, according to recent market data, gas pool heaters with an efficiency rating of 80% or higher can save up to 30% on energy bills compared to standard models. Moreover, features like digital controls, remote monitoring, and smart connectivity often found in modern heaters add to the overall price due to advanced technology integration.
The market also offers a range of options based on size and capacity. Smaller, compact heaters suitable for smaller pools or spas will generally be less expensive than larger, more powerful units designed for commercial or large residential applications. Additionally, factors like additional features (e.g., backup heating elements, automatic shut-off valves), warranty periods, and brand reputation can influence pricing.
